Architects get disciplinary tribunal

The Chief Justice of Nigeria (CJN),  Justice Mahmud Mohammed, has granted approval to the Architects Registration Council of Nigeria (ARCON) to set up a disciplinary tribunal that will help checkmate quacks, among others.
The president of the council, Arc. Umaru Aliyu, disclosed this, last week, during the council’s conference in Abuja.
He said the council yearned foe establishment of the tribunal since 2012 without success until now.
Aliyu said that the development would help checkmate the activities of quacks and sanitise the profession.
He said that the country was witnessing incidents of building collapse because many people have refused to engage the services of architects, adding that all architectural jobs should be done by architects registered by ARCON.
